Grant Green - VisionsGrant Green embraced R&B and jazz funk on his 1971 album Visions featuring Billy Wooten, Emmanuel Riggins, Chuck Rainey, Idris Muhammad, Ray Armando, and Harold Caldwell. The guitarists distinctive tone, and melodicism elevate songs by The Jackson 5, Chicago, The Carpenters, Mozart, and Quincy Jones Maybe Tomorrow which was later sampled by Kendrick Lamar.
